I've heard before from a couple of people "you can only follow 300 people, if you follow anymore, lichess will delete them". Is this actually true? If it is.. why??
That used to be true, now Lichess tells you when you're trying to follow more than 300 people and just won't let you.

The reason is that following hundreds of people is expensive on the database, so there has to be a limit.
